Proclamation ceremony for future space economy roadmap

President Yoon Seok-yeol attended the Proclamation ceremony for future space economy roadmap held at the JW Marriott Hotel in Seoul on November 28th. About 150 people from domestic and international space-related institutions and companies attended the proclamation ceremony. Yoon announced the “Future Space Economy Roadmap,” which contains the policy direction until 2045 for Korea to leap forward as a space economy powerhouse. He emphasized that in the future, a country with a vision for space can lead the global economy and solve the problems facing mankind. He added that the dream of becoming a space power is not a distant future, but an opportunity and hope for children and young people. The contents of the roadmap are as follows: development of an independent launch vehicle engine capable of flying to the moon within 5 years, landing on the moon in 2032 and starting resource mining, and landing on Mars in 2045. He said that he would establish an expert-oriented and project-oriented space agency, and prepare for the space economy era with the president directly serving as the chairman of the National Space Council. On the same day, the Korea Aerospace Administration Establishment Promotion Team was launched within the Ministry of Science and ICT. Domestic space development-related companies announced the ‘Joint Declaration for the Realization of the Space Economy’, which strengthens their will to actively participate in the government’s policy. About 70 companies, including Hanwha Aerospace, LIG Nex1, and KT SAT, participated in the announcement of the joint declaration.

 

59th Trade Day

President Yoon Seok-yeol attended the ‘59th Trade Day’ event held at COEX, Seoul Trade Center on Monday, December 5. Yoon encouraged the hard work of traders who achieved the highest export amount ever and ranked 6th in the world despite difficult conditions. Following the 1st export strategy meeting held on November 23, he participated in the defense industry export strategy meeting held on November 24 and continues to promote exports. In his congratulatory remarks on the 59th Trade Day, he said “Exports have always been a strong support for our economy, and are the backbone of our economy and a source of jobs. In order for Korea to become one of the top five export powerhouses by 2026, the government will mobilize all export support capabilities through the ¡ÙExport Strategy Meeting¡Ú presided over by the President and the ¡ÙAll in One Export/Order Support Group¡Ú. Future summit diplomacy will focus on promoting exports of Korean companies and advancing overseas. We will actively foster nuclear power, defense, and overseas infrastructure as new flagship export industries by making full use of Team Korea.”
